James Halloran BREMNER

Regimental number11/215
AddressGisborne
Marital statusSingle
Next of kinFather, W G Bremner, Gisborne
Rank on embarkationTrooper
Enlistment statusVolunteer
Unit nameNew Zealand Expeditionary Force, Main Body, Wellington Mounted Rifles Regiment
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Wellington on 16 October 1914
Members of the Wellington Mounted Rifles Regiment in the Main Body left New Zealand on board three ships ('Arawa', 'Orari', and 'Tahiti'). It is not possible from the Nominal Roll to determine on which ship an individual embarked.
Final rankTrooper
Final unit9th Squadron, Wellington Mounted Rifles Regiment
FateDied of wounds 8 September 1915
Age at death from cemetery records24
Commemoration detailsChunuk Bair (New Zealand) Memorial, Gallipoli, Turkey

Parents: William Gordon Bremner and Mary Alice Bremner, Porangahau
Family/military connectionsBrothers: 11/213 Lance Corporal John Robertson BREMNER, No 1 Company, New Zealand Machine Gun Corps, killed in action, 22 June 1916; 24852 Trooper William Gilbert Booth BREMNER, Wellington Mounted Rifles Regiment, died of wounds, 20 July 1917.
Other details

War service: Egypt, Gallipoli

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
